## Migrating SproutCycle to the new scheduler

Welcome aboard! SproutCycle's watering jobs used to live in a cron tab on the old Fernhollow box, but we've moved everything into the Drizzlekit runtime. Before you run the migration script, double-check that your local profile points at the staging greenhouse cluster. Once that's confirmed, paste in the config values shown below.

deployment values, fafop-fahip:
[eliax]
host = eliax.zemvarcorp.corp
user = eliax_svc
database = eliax_prod

## Break-Glass: Conversion Rounding Audit

If the Marivel ledger shows rounding drift above 0.5 basis points in currency conversion, break-glass access to the rate-adjustment console is authorized. Document the drift amount, affected pairs, and reviewer approval before proceeding. To unseal the console, the steward must supply the recovery passphrase recorded below.

vault phrase of kahip-bajog = praath-gordor-juleth-istys-quenion

## Branchreaper: Limits and Quotas

Branchreaper scans every repo in the Tindervale org nightly and flags branches with no commits past the staleness window. Flagged branches get a warning comment, then deletion after the grace period. Protected branches and anything matching the release pattern are always skipped. Per-repo deletion counts are capped to avoid mass removals during migrations. Current limits are set as follows.

limits module of tawep-hawif:
WEIGHTS = {
    "sordor": 228,
    "kasax": 458,
    "ulaox": 8,
    "casix": 495,
    "briix": 335,
}

## Changelog — TilePorter 3.2

Changed defaults for the map-tile prefetcher. Prefetch radius reduced from 5 to 2 zoom rings; anonymous prefetch over untrusted networks is now disabled; cache entries are signed before reuse. Rationale: prior defaults allowed an on-path attacker to poison the tile cache and infer user routes from prefetch patterns. Upgrades keep existing overrides; fresh installs get the new baseline. Security review should confirm the signing requirement cannot be toggled off by clients. Effective defaults shipped in 3.2 follow.

service settings:
PRAWYN_PIN=9848
PRAWYN_METRICS_HOST=metrics.prawyn.lumicworks.corp
PRAWYN_LOG_LEVEL=warn
PRAWYN_TENANT=pelius